Major Rating Factors: A five year analysis of stability tests including evaluations of capital adequacy, asset growth, and profitability lead to a Very Weak overall stability index (1.0 on a scale of 0 to 10). Operating profits as a percentage of assets at 0.2%, coupled with a return on assets of 0.2 has resulted in Weak (1.5) profitability.
Other Rating Factors: Weak liquidity 1.8, driven by a liquidity ratio of 8.6 percent and a “hot money” ratio of 0.0 percent. A current level of 11.7 percent of nonperforming loans to core capital combined with 26.0 percent from a year earlier contributes to the Good asset quality (5.5).
Asset Mix: Consumer loans (77%), securities (0%), other (23%)
